Kirjoittaja Aihe: /var/log ongelma  (Luettu 2784 kertaa)

nebula

  • Käyttäjä
  • Viestejä: 438
    • Profiili
/var/log ongelma
« : 25.12.08 - klo:18.36 »
yritin polttaa Braserolla dvd-levyä, mutta tuli error että levytila on loppu.
No... katsoin mikä vie kaiken tilan ja paljastui että /var/log kansiossa on on kolme TEKSTItiedostoa... 
-kern.log 1.2 GT
-syslog 1.2 GT
-messages 1.1GT

... aikas isoja tekstitiedostoja  ;D

Yritin avata geditillä, mutta gedit kaatuu (ilm. liian isoja tiedostoja sillekin)

Ilmeisesti noi on vaan lokitiedostoja, joten voiko ne ihan vaan kylmästi poistaa?
En tosin tiedä mikä ohjelma on ollut niin jumissa että on ne lokit täyttänyt, enkä saa niitä edes auki (järjestelmä->ylläpito->järjestelmälokikin kaatuu kun yrittää avata)

nyt on levy täysi, joten voiko noi tiedostot turvallisesti poistaa ja alkaa seurata mikä ne täyttää... jos täyttää?

anttimr

  • Käyttäjä
  • Viestejä: 1625
    • Profiili
Vs: /var/log ongelma
« Vastaus #1 : 25.12.08 - klo:19.14 »
nyt on levy täysi, joten voiko noi tiedostot turvallisesti poistaa ja alkaa seurata mikä ne täyttää... jos täyttää?

Joo, logit voi poistaa ilman haittavaikutuksia pääkäyttäjän oikeuksilla (sudo rm ...), mutta toisaalta olisi viisasta ensin vilkaista mikä niitä täyttää. Päätteessä on hyvä katsoa lokin viimeistä sataa riviä esimerkiksi näin:

Koodia: [Valitse]
tail -n 100 /var/log/syslog |less
Ota sekin huomioon, että vanhoja lokeja on luultavasti pakattu .tar.gz päätteisiin tiedostoihin.  Nekin vievät tilaa turhaan ja voisi samalla poistaa. Systeemin jumittelu voi tietenkin johtua myös tupaten täydestä levystä. Tilanne on helppo tarkistaa päätteessä komennolla

Koodia: [Valitse]
df -h /
« Viimeksi muokattu: 25.12.08 - klo:19.17 kirjoittanut anttimr »
Ubuntu 12.10 Quantal Quetzal

Storck

  • Vieras
Vs: /var/log ongelma
« Vastaus #2 : 25.12.08 - klo:19.14 »
Kyllä on järkyttävä määrä tavaraa, itselläni:
kern.log = 300 kiloa
sys.log = 160 kiloa
messages = 240 kiloa

Odota viisaampien neuvoa niiden tyhtentämisestä   :)

gdm

  • Sitä saa mitä tilaa...
  • Käyttäjä
  • Viestejä: 4363
    • Profiili
    • Keskustelualueiden säännöt
Vs: /var/log ongelma
« Vastaus #3 : 25.12.08 - klo:19.46 »
nyt on levy täysi, joten voiko noi tiedostot turvallisesti poistaa ja alkaa seurata mikä ne täyttää... jos täyttää?

Joo, logit voi poistaa ilman haittavaikutuksia pääkäyttäjän oikeuksilla (sudo rm ...), mutta toisaalta olisi viisasta ensin vilkaista mikä niitä täyttää. Päätteessä on hyvä katsoa lokin viimeistä sataa riviä esimerkiksi näin:

Koodia: [Valitse]
tail -n 100 /var/log/syslog |less

Aivan, hyvä tarkistaa onko siellä mitään toistuvaa kaavaa viesteissä.
Sillä ei normaalisti kuuluisi kasvaa noin isoiksi.
Lisää [Ratkaistu] aloitusviestiin jos ongelmasi selviää!
Saamasi tuki on ilmaista, joten älä vaadi tai uhkaile saadaksesi apua!

Jtkone

  • Käyttäjä
  • Viestejä: 895
    • Profiili
Vs: /var/log ongelma
« Vastaus #4 : 25.12.08 - klo:19.51 »
Viisaudesta en tiedä, mutta tämä on turvallinen tapa (nimittäin suoraan roskikseen kippaamalla tuollainen määrä tavaraa voi olla edessä sama kuin avata niitä johonkin txt editoriin. Tarkasta myös pakatut tiedostot. Jos kohtuullisen kokoisia niin jätä paikalleen. Voi joskus olla tarvetta.

Siis avaa ylläpitopääte päätteessä sudo xterm
Uudessa päätteessä (on siis rootin) komenna cat /dev/null/ > /var/log/kern.log
ja sama muille .log tiedostoille
Juu ja jotakin mätää tuossa on kun on noin hervottoman kokoisia.

Tuplanolla

  • Käyttäjä
  • Viestejä: 1420
  • Reg. Linux user #423604
    • Profiili
Vs: /var/log ongelma
« Vastaus #5 : 25.12.08 - klo:20.43 »
Puitiin tätä IRC:n puolella ja vaikuttaisi tältä: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/94821
Lisää [ratkaistu] ketjun ensimmäisen viestin otsikkoon, kun ongelma ratkeaa!

Squirrel

  • Käyttäjä
  • Viestejä: 455
    • Profiili
Vs: /var/log ongelma
« Vastaus #6 : 25.12.08 - klo:23.11 »
Itsellä logrotate pakkaa tiedostot viikottain ja 4 viikkoa vanhat logit poistetaan.

Välttämättä ei ole mitään vikaa, jotkut ohjelmat typerästi tekee kaikki logit system.log ja kern.logiin. (jos olet asentanut paljon huonosti koodattuja ohjelmia). Katsomalla se selviää.
Toivoisin tulevan päivä päivältä paremmaksi tietokoneen käyttäjäksi

nebula

  • Käyttäjä
  • Viestejä: 438
    • Profiili
Vs: /var/log ongelma
« Vastaus #7 : 26.12.08 - klo:13.18 »
Juu... Tuplanollan kanssa tota IRC:ssä puitiin ja ihan kylmästi rm:llä poistin tiedostot.

Pitää alkaa seurailee jos tulee lisää noita, niin sitten pitää alkaa keksiä ratkaisua, mutta tod.näk. oli vaan joku paikallinen bugi.

Kiitos vastaajille